Mysore Palace - A Royal Journey

Mysore Palace, akin to the Eiffel Tower in Paris, is a must-visit architectural marvel dating back to the 14th century. Dive into the city's royal history as you stroll through its corridors, capturing insta-worthy moments. For a unique experience, visit on Sundays or public holidays when the palace illuminates after 7 pm, offering a breathtaking view of this gorgeous structure from a new perspective.

Cycling Adventure Around Mysore

Immerse yourself in the local culture by exploring the city on two wheels. Rent a cycle or join a guided bicycle tour (priced between INR 1,500 - and INR 2,000) to discover hidden gems like Balmari and Edmuri Falls, KRS Dam, and Chamundi Hills. Early morning rides provide a different perspective on this heritage town, allowing you to truly understand the city's cultural nuances beyond the popular tourist spots.

Trek to Chamundi Hills - A Scenic Escape

For those seeking a bit more adventure, embark on a scenic trek to Chamundi Hills. With a moderate intensity level, the trail offers stunning views of Mysore from the hill's summit. Navigate the 1200 steps, but beware of mischievous monkeys at the beginning of the trail. Cap off your trek with refreshing tender coconut water and relish the picturesque panorama of the city.

Mysore Markets - A Kaleidoscope of Colors

Experience the tranquility of Mysore's markets, a unique departure from the bustling markets of North India. Capture the vibrant and organized atmosphere while exploring Devaraja Market, renowned for its fruits, vegetables, and spices. Unwind as you observe the local life unfolding, making these markets a must-visit among the best places in Mysore. Exercise caution to avoid scams and make the most of your market exploration.
